In the sectikn 5.3 under point 4b it specifies the maximum value of the year
but does not give any details of the minimum value.
Suggested text:
For the types xs:date, xs:time, xs:dateTime, xs:gYear, and xs:gYearMonth: the
minimum and maximum value of the year component (must be at least 1 to 9999)
and the maximum number of fractional second digits (must be at least 3).
